Transaction aded88dc2f7533c99faea248619aa72389e112fcf1ac2a60eb0e18539daaa42b

1 Input
2 Outputs
  • aded88dc2f7533c99faea248619aa72389e112fcf1ac2a60eb0e18539daaa42b:0
  • value  102255690
    address  3EmH62bjnKyTLgMrEfdaSwPy4YC1fCRyDP
  • aded88dc2f7533c99faea248619aa72389e112fcf1ac2a60eb0e18539daaa42b:1
  • value  234526140
    address  39pi5LkF4QNJVaBL7skZ52TuSUfxCZ2kRh